A member of our marketing team wants to use Outbrain Select to curate content to augment the original content we have on our site.
http://www.outbrain.com/select/how
This content would be taken from other pages on the site and shown through as though it is on our site through javascipt. Obviously this page would be setup as a no-index.
This seems to me like something Google would frown on. Does anyone know the SEO implications behind using a tool like this? I'm concerned google will see links to a blank page no-index page and find it suspect.

If the text is shown via an iframe, it won't count as any kind of beneficial content. If it's actually scraped and rendered on your site, it will likely be classified as duplicate content.
The best organizations recognize that creating original content is important and they put the grueling hours in to do it. It's hard but it's worth it.

Generally agreed with EGOL here. Not sure why you'd want this on your website, but if it's a single page that is noindexed and uncrawlable, I don't see a problem with it, either. Just make sure it's "noindex, follow" so you're not blocking up the page from passing any link equity it accumulates.
